Ingredients for Caramel Pecan Cake

1 German Chocolate Cake Mix

3 eggs

1 1/3 cups water

1/2 cup vegetable oil

1 (11 oz) bag of Kraft caramels unwrapped

1/4 cup milk

1/3 cup butter

2 cups chocolate chips

1 cup chopped pecans

How to Make a Caramel Pecan Cake

Mix the cake mix together per package instructions. Pour half of the batter into a greased 9 x 13 baking pan and bake for 20 minutes at 350 degrees.

While this bakes, put unwrapped caramels, milk and butter into a small sauce pan and melt over low heat. It is very important to stir constantly until the caramel is melted and smooth.

When the cake is done, pour the caramel on top as soon as you take it out of the oven.

Sprinkle the chocolate chips and pecans onto the caramel. Spread the remaining cake batter on top and spread to the very edges of the pan. Try to cover all the caramel, chocolate chips and pecans. This is the most difficult step and it doesn't have to look perfect to taste great!

Bake for 20 more minutes at 350 degrees.
